Читайте также: |
|
Создать приложение для просмотра и редактирования разных таблиц.
Пользователь может выбирать таблицу, данные которой выводятся в сетке DBGrid1. Выбор осуществляется в диалоге открытия файла, который вызывается при нажатии на кнопку «Открыть другую таблицу». После выбора таблицы ее имя устанавливается в качестве значения свойства TableName набора данных Table1.
При задании расположения БД программным способом НД предварительно необходимо закрыть (свойство Active = False).
Расположите на форме компоненты, показанные на рисунке. В компоненте DBGrid должна отображаться таблица Tovar.db
Напишите обработчик события OnClick для кнопки «Открыть другую таблицу»:
procedure TForm1.Button1Click(Sender: TObject);
Begin
OpenDialog1.Filter:= 'Таблицы (*.db;*.dbf) | *.db;*.dbf | Все файлы | *.*';
If OpenDialog1.Execute then
Begin
table1.Active:=false;
table1.tablename:=Opendialog1.FileName;
table1.Active:=true;
end;
end;
Напишите обработчик события OnCreate для формы:
procedure TForm1.FormCreate(Sender: TObject);
Begin
DataSource1.DataSet:=Table1;
DBGrid1.DataSource:=DataSource1;
end;
Запустите программу и нажмите на кнопку «Открыть другую таблицу». В появившемся диалоговом окне зайдите в папку Baza и двойным щелчком выберите любую таблицу.
Дата добавления: 2015-07-19; просмотров: 45 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Набор данных | | | Самостоятельная работа |